Transaction 3ede8050de5c440c4b82fc7090442719762a1f917fb256b5a859c612162f88f4

1 Input
2 Outputs
  • 3ede8050de5c440c4b82fc7090442719762a1f917fb256b5a859c612162f88f4:0
  • value  20657187
    address  3DxPU5WjtMNHobhy2LiqWV919SCGYtL6rC
  • 3ede8050de5c440c4b82fc7090442719762a1f917fb256b5a859c612162f88f4:1
  • value  12784656
    address  3Basg4wmfrCwoQy9gCNRNjsR1rVLeG6VKs